The Hidden Cost of Manual Workflows in HVAC

The Hidden Cost of Manual Workflows in HVAC

Every minute spent double-checking schedules, chasing parts, or clarifying customer requests is a minute lost to revenue-generating work. For HVAC companies, manual workflows aren’t just inconvenient—they’re a silent profit killer.

Scheduling inefficiencies alone can derail an entire service day. Technicians arrive late, customers wait longer, and follow-up jobs get pushed. Without real-time visibility into availability, location, and job complexity, dispatchers operate blind.

Service backlogs grow when administrative tasks pile up: - Missed service windows due to poor routing
- Duplicate data entry across systems
- Uncoordinated technician assignments
- Lack of urgency prioritization
- No automated rescheduling for delays

These inefficiencies compound. A PwC study estimates AI could improve productivity by 40% by 2035 across industries, including HVAC—highlighting how much ground manual operations lose today.

Inventory mismanagement is another major bottleneck. Without predictive insights, companies either overstock slow-moving items or run out of critical parts. This leads to delayed repairs, emergency shipments, and frustrated customers.

Meanwhile, TechRoute AI has demonstrated 20–30% reductions in drive time by optimizing routes dynamically. That’s more jobs per day, less fuel, and faster response times—all achievable with intelligent automation.

Consider a mid-sized HVAC firm handling 150 service calls weekly. With manual dispatching, technicians average 2.8 jobs per day. After implementing route-aware scheduling, that jumps to 3.8 jobs—adding 50+ billable visits monthly without hiring a single new tech.

Why Off-the-Shelf AI Tools Fall Short

Generic AI platforms promise quick fixes—but for HVAC companies, they often create more problems than they solve. These off-the-shelf tools lack the depth needed to handle mission-critical operations like dispatching, compliance logging, and real-time inventory tracking.

Brittle integrations are a major pain point. Most no-code solutions rely on fragile third-party connectors that break whenever a CRM, ERP, or scheduling system updates its API. This leads to workflow failures, data sync issues, and unplanned downtime.

According to a practitioner with years in the AI automation space,

"Tools I built just 6–12 months ago are already obsolete because platforms like OpenAI and Zapier changed their APIs."
This sentiment, shared in a Reddit discussion among AI automation professionals, highlights the unsustainable churn of relying on no-code assemblers.

These platforms also suffer from siloed data and shallow connections. Instead of unifying operations, they patch systems together superficially—CRM data doesn’t talk to field service logs, and inventory updates lag behind real-time job completions.

Common limitations include: - Fragile integrations that break with software updates - No ownership of the underlying AI infrastructure - Poor scalability beyond basic workflows - Limited customization for HVAC-specific rules - Dependency on monthly subscriptions with uncertain long-term ROI

One HVAC contractor reported paying for ChatGPT Plus for eight months but using it less than expected, overwhelmed by fragmented tools and unclear value. As noted in a Reddit user experience, this "AI FOMO" leads to subscription bloat without measurable operational gains.

Without deep integration into existing systems, off-the-shelf tools can’t access real-time technician availability, parts inventory, or safety checklists—critical inputs for intelligent automation in field service.

Manual scheduling wastes time and costs jobs. Technicians get assigned inefficiently, leading to longer drives, delayed responses, and overtime burnout.

A dynamic service scheduling agent automates dispatch by analyzing real-time data: technician location, skill set, availability, traffic, and job urgency. Instead of guessing who should go where, AI makes optimal matches instantly.

This isn’t theoretical. Tools like ServiceTitan already show how AI-driven dispatch improves routing, but custom systems go further. By integrating directly with your CRM and ERP, AIQ Labs ensures two-way data flow—no more syncing errors or duplicate entries.

Benefits include: - Up to 30% reduction in drive time, enabling more daily service calls - Automatic rescheduling for cancellations or emergencies - Load balancing across technicians to prevent burnout - Priority-based job routing (e.g., emergency repairs first) - Seamless sync with calendars and customer notifications
